Output 14b835da6fab6ea3d177c561b2b343e1b092e7942dd077c59dee2fe174603749:0

value
1664550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f309ffc48c4b6fcd59f23dbf6426981da4e1f8f4 OP_EQUAL
address
3Pr66ubjz4UcJoXGC8Xk6jUiB7uzPpbz2s
transaction
14b835da6fab6ea3d177c561b2b343e1b092e7942dd077c59dee2fe174603749